PHAM NEWS | DECEMBER/JANUARY 2025 People on theMove


Water treatment specialist Fernox has announced the promotion of Mike Skivington to sales director for the UK and Ireland. With over 14 years of experience in the heating and plumbing sector, Mike will lead sales operations and strategic initiatives. He was previously the company’s southern regional sales director.


Sanifl o has welcomed Wendy Shore to the sales team. After 18 years in key accounts and regional sales roles at Baxi, Wendy joined Sanifl o as national sales manager in July 2024 and is responsible for driving growth of Sanifl o products through a team of area sales managers. She also worked at British Gas for 12 years.


Kevin Goodison has been appointed regional technical sales manager (Midlands) at Conex Bänninger. Previously with Fränkische UK, Kevin brings 25 years of HVAC experience and will focus on strengthening relationships with existing installers and merchants while seeking new customer opportunities.


ATAG Heating has appointed Ian Golden as the new national sales director. Ian previously served as key accounts director, and in his new role he will oversee the national sales strategy, focusing on growth and expanding the company’s presence in the UK while leading the sales team to support ATAG’s partners.


Heating control manufacturer Heatmiser has appointed Neil Budd as its new business development manager. With experience from Wavin and Purmo Group, Budd will help drive market expansion following Heatmiser’s integration into IMI’s Climate Control division.


British ground source heat pump supplier Kensa has appointed Paul Donovan (pictured) as chair of the board, succeeding Lord Matthew Taylor, who is retiring after ten years. Donovan brings extensive experience in scaling businesses, having held leadership roles in the mobile communications sector and private equity- backed companies.

Ambion Heating has appointed Denis Harley as business development manager to expand its presence in Scotland. With his extensive experience in the Scottish social housing sector, Denis will help Ambion tap into the region’s potential for low-carbon heating solutions, particularly in smaller and multi-occupancy buildings.


Isabelle Eccleston has joined Stelrad as a brand specialist for the South Central region. A Bournemouth University graduate, Isabelle’s new role will see her visiting all the merchant branches in her territory and liaising with installers, carrying out product training locally for them.
